This is an automated email from the ASF dual-hosted git repository.
morrysnow p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/doris.git
from c25b9071ad [opt](conf) Modify brpc work pool conf default value #22406
add 450e0b1078 [fix](nereids) recompute logical properties in plan post
process (#22356)
No new revisions were added by this update.
Summary of changes:
.../nereids/processor/post/PlanPostProcessors.java | 1 +
...va => RecomputeLogicalPropertiesProcessor.java} | 13 +++---
.../LogicalExceptToPhysicalExcept.java | 1 +
.../LogicalIntersectToPhysicalIntersect.java | 1 +
.../LogicalUnionToPhysicalUnion.java | 1 +
.../LogicalWindowToPhysicalWindow.java | 1 +
.../doris/nereids/trees/plans/AbstractPlan.java | 12 ++++++
.../trees/plans/logical/AbstractLogicalPlan.java | 13 ------
.../trees/plans/physical/AbstractPhysicalJoin.java | 11 +++++
.../trees/plans/physical/AbstractPhysicalPlan.java | 7 +++-
.../plans/physical/PhysicalAssertNumRows.java | 6 +++
.../trees/plans/physical/PhysicalCTEAnchor.java | 12 ++++++
.../trees/plans/physical/PhysicalCTEProducer.java | 12 ++++++
.../trees/plans/physical/PhysicalDistribute.java | 11 +++++
.../trees/plans/physical/PhysicalExcept.java | 30 ++++++++-----
.../trees/plans/physical/PhysicalFileSink.java | 12 ++++++
.../trees/plans/physical/PhysicalFilter.java | 12 ++++++
.../trees/plans/physical/PhysicalGenerate.java | 15 +++++++
.../plans/physical/PhysicalHashAggregate.java | 15 +++++++
.../trees/plans/physical/PhysicalHashJoin.java | 6 +++
.../trees/plans/physical/PhysicalIntersect.java | 29 ++++++++-----
.../trees/plans/physical/PhysicalLimit.java | 12 ++++++
.../plans/physical/PhysicalNestedLoopJoin.java | 7 ++++
.../plans/physical/PhysicalOlapTableSink.java | 6 +++
.../plans/physical/PhysicalPartitionTopN.java | 12 ++++++
.../nereids/trees/plans/physical/PhysicalPlan.java | 4 ++
.../trees/plans/physical/PhysicalProject.java | 13 ++++++
.../trees/plans/physical/PhysicalQuickSort.java | 12 ++++++
.../trees/plans/physical/PhysicalRepeat.java | 6 +++
.../trees/plans/physical/PhysicalResultSink.java | 15 +++++++
.../trees/plans/physical/PhysicalSetOperation.java | 15 +++++++
.../nereids/trees/plans/physical/PhysicalTopN.java | 13 ++++++
.../trees/plans/physical/PhysicalUnion.java | 49 +++++++++++++---------
.../trees/plans/physical/PhysicalWindow.java | 37 +++++++++++++---
.../doris/nereids/trees/plans/PlanOutputTest.java | 32 --------------
.../data/nereids_syntax_p0/join_order.out | 3 ++
.../suites/nereids_syntax_p0/join_order.groovy | 10 +++++
37 files changed, 368 insertions(+), 99 deletions(-)
copy
fe/fe-core/src/main/java/org/apache/doris/nereids/processor/post/{PlanPostProcessor.java
=> RecomputeLogicalPropertiesProcessor.java} (71%)
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]